Definitions and meanings of "Assignor"

What do we mean by assignor?

One that makes an assignment. noun

In law, one who makes an assignment, or assigns an interest. noun

An assigner; a person who assigns or transfers an interest. noun

The person or party which makes an assignment. noun

(law) the party who makes an assignment noun
